Gas Chromatography/Mass Spectrometry (GC/MS) is a combination of two techniques: Gas Chromatography and Mass Spectrometry. It uses internal standards and provides identification and quantification of drugs and serves as the gold standard in the confirming the abuse of prohibited drugs such as heroin.</div>

Gas Chromatography is a technique used to separate the drugs that may be present in the patient's sample. The chromatography column is a long tubular column where the sample is injected and is swept through the column by means of a gas such as helium. Drugs present are separated from one another since some drugs take longer to pass as compared with others. The chemical characteristics of drugs the time it takes for the drug to travel through the chromatography column. This is referred to as the <b>retention time </b>which is an identifying characteristic of the drug.</div>

Mass Spectrometry is the detector of Gas Chromatography. When the drug exits from the GC column, it is separated via <b>ionization. </b>The fragments are sorted by mass forming a <b>fragmentation pattern </b>which is also an identifying characteristic of a drug which is said to be as unique as a fingerprint.</div>

This standard is a deuterated version of the drug being tested and has similar characteristics with the one that is being tested. A precise amount is added before preparation so that the IS is prepared and analyzed similarly with the drug assayed. Quantification of the drug and qualification of the assay is done by comparing the signals produced by the internal standard with the signals produced of the drug being tested. The deuterated drug is made by substituting one or more hydrogen atoms with a deuterium atom. It exhibits similar characteristics as the non-deuterated drug but can be differentiated by the detection of the fragment mass.</div>
<div style="text-align: justify;">
<br /></div>
<div style="text-align: justify;">
<br /></div>
<div style="text-align: justify;">
Drugs are identified by the combination of its retention time by means of gas chromatography, fragmentation by means of mass spectrometry and specific information due to the presence of the IS</div>

When an addict stops heroin use, this drug will no longer act as an opiod receptor in the central nervous system. The body then tries to normalize brain function. Prolonged heroin use causes the body to become dependent to it and adapts to its presence. When heroin is suddenly reduced, withdrawal symptoms occur. Therefore, the more heroin is taken, worse withdrawal symptoms occur. Detoxification from heroin will make the body think that it is not working properly since it has already adapted to its presence which is why heroin withdrawal is difficult.<br />
<div style="text-align: justify;">
<br /></div>
<div style="text-align: justify;">
After 6-24 hours of not using heroin, withdrawal symptoms occur.These symptoms may include inner restlessness, chills, constipation, fever, malaise, nausea, and vomiting. Latent withdrawal symptoms include abnormal cramps, diarrhea, dilated pupils, disturbed sleep, depression and drug cravings. These symptoms will only subside a week after the last heroin use.</div>

<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">Metabolites or
circulating drugs may be detected in hair. First, these are deposited in the
hair follicle and as the hair grows out, the metabolites will get trapped on
the hair shaft and then in the keratin matrix. Drugs may also enter the hair
through sweat, oil or the external environment. A 3-cm hair specimen may be
able to indicate whether or not the person has been abusing drugs in the past 3
months. It is recommended that the hair specimen must be approximately 1.5 inches
for drug abuse testing. When a person takes a drug, it takes approximately 4 to
5 days for the affected shaft to grow. However, there are a lot of factors that
may affect the levels of the drug incorporated in a person’s hair. This means
that high levels do not necessarily mean a more frequent drug abuse. It was demonstrated by Rothe et al that the doses of administered heroin and the measured concentration of opiates from the hair specimen were not correlated. The drug purity, metabolism, frequency of abuse and hair color are the factors that may affect the drug or metabolite amount incorporated in hair.<o:p></o:p></span><br />
<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;"><br /></span>
<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;"><br /></span></div>
<div class="MsoNormal" style="text-align: justify;">
<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/proxy/AVvXsEjlYbNaupx2DSPeW5wEz-tnndJb-ypFPWkv2UCECSiZxwNaEmEF0W_1hGZnsRfRsWJx8npW4FQXRH8EuWUTd1wzFgbqjupj2WeaqFsMJQ7Z6k2GSkFWqEqtv_Fz48Xr_UhYLzgJ-rUmwuybXNjZPctl1ThLxnf7FLQ2u14=" imageanchor="1" style="clear: left; float: left; margin-bottom: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" src="http://www.buzzle.com/img/articleImages/306080-54410-59.jpg" height="320" width="208" /></a><span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;"><br /></span></div>
<br />
<div class="MsoNormal" style="text-align: justify;">
<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">Natural hair color is
an important factor in evaluating drug concentration. Drugs or metabolites are
less incorporated in white fibers as compared with the pigmented ones. Melanin
contains eumelanin which is accountable for hair with the colors black or brown
whereas pheomelanin is responsible for red-colored hair. Drugs tend to bind
less to pheomelanin than in eumelanin. Low abuse of drugs might not be detected
in treated hair (e.g. bleached, permed or dyed). However, it can be detected in
regular drug abuse but with reduced concentrations. Bleached or
chemically-treated hair is more at risk to environmental drug uptake. Drugs
already incorporated in hair are less removed in shampooing but this is
effective in removing drugs absorbed from the environment. In hair follicle drug testing, heroin abuse can be detected as long as 90 days prior to testing.<o:p></o:p></span><br />

<span style="font-family: 'Times New Roman', serif; font-size: 12pt; line-height: 115%;">Hair sample is obtained
and tested under the guidelines of the Society of Hair Testing. First, hair is
thoroughly washed with the use of an organic solvent and with water
subsequently. The washes can also be tested for the presence of the drug and
its metabolites. After washing, the hair is cut into pieces and a small part is
to be tested using Enzyme-linked Immunosorbent Assay (ELISA).</span></div>

<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">For this test, approximately
50 to 80 strands (45 mg) of hair are needed. There is slight variation due to
hair color, thickness and texture. Samples obtained directly from hair comb or
brush may not be used as samples should be taken live from the patient by
cutting the hair strand as close to the scalp as possible.<o:p></o:p></span></div>

<span style="font-size: 12pt; line-height: 115%;"><span style="font-family: inherit;">Drug abuse testing may
be performed using saliva as the specimen. Mixed saliva or “oral fluid” comes
from the salivary glands, oral mucosa and gingival cervices. Drugs from the
blood are transported to the saliva by means of passive diffusion. Within just
a few minutes, the drugs and metabolites present in plasma are distributed to
the salivary glands and are diffused into the saliva after parenteral administration.
Therefore, the concentration of the drug in the saliva is correlated with the
drug concentration in blood. Saliva is capable of retaining trace amounts of drugs
and its metabolites for about 24-36 hours. However, Alain Verstraete from Yale University had reported that upon consumption of opiates, it only takes about 5 hours up to 48 hours for it to become undetectable in saliva. <o:p></o:p></span></span></div>

<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">The test device
contains an absorbent pad wherein the sample that contains the drugs and its
metabolites compete with the drug conjugate that is immobilized on a porous
membrane for limited antibody sites. As the sample flows through the absorbent
pad, the free drug that is contained in the saliva binds with the labeled
antibody-dye conjugate now forming an antibody-antigen complex. This complex
competes with the immobilized antigen conjugate located in the “test” zone and
will not produce a colored band when the drug exceeds the detection level. A
colored band is formed in the “control zone” when the unbound dye conjugate
binds with the reagent indicating that the device is functioning properly.<o:p></o:p></span></div>

Urine is the most widely used specimen for drugs of abuse testing because of the advantages of large specimen volume and relatively high drug concentrations that render drug detection comparatively easier than in other specimens. Drugs in urine are detectable by standard drug test on urine between 1-3days. Urine sample of individual is under tightly controlled condition.<br />
<br />
The person will likely be asked to go to a testing facility where he or she will need to remove street clothing and put on a hospital gown. This ensures that a clean sample from someone else is not removed in to the testing center and substituted fort the subject's urine.<br />
<br />
Once they changed into the gown, he or she is accompanied to the testing area. This is a washroom where the water in the toilet tank has been dyed so that an attempt to water down the sample by adding toilet water will be quite obvious. The water supply at the sink will have been shut off so that a person will not intended to use that source of liquid to alter the sample. A staff member will be waiting nearby to take the sample once it has been provided. The standard protocol is to test it to confirm that the temperature is consistent with normal body temperature.<br />
<br />
A negative reading on drug test doesn’t mean that there is no presence of heroin in the body. According to Mandatory Guidelines for Federal Workplace Drug Testing Program, it simply means that sample taken didn't record a level higher than the threshold.<br />
<br />
<br />
The cutoff value is 2000 nanograms per milliliter. It is usually repeated when the initial urine test is positive for drugs, including horse. If a second result have reach the cutoff value 2000 ng/ml means it is positive and the subject will be facing consequences, and none of them will be good.<br />

Usage of Heroin during pregnancy can also cause dilemma to the fetus. It results to the so called Neonatal Abstinence Syndrome or NAS. This occurs when the drug passes through the placenta which will cause the baby to become dependent to the mother. Symptoms may include prolonged or non-stop crying, high fever, malaise, diarrhea, vomitting, seizures and possibly death if not treated immediately. Treatment for this includes intensive prenatal care, hospitalization and appropriate medications until the baby becomes opioid-free. </div>

<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;"><br /></span><span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">In 1898, Heinrick
Dresser, a worker of the Bayer Laboratory, developed diacetylmorphine in search
of a non-addictive substitute for morphine. This drug was manufactured by the
Bayer German Pharmaceutical Company. It was marketed under the trademark name <b>Heroin</b> which was then used to treat
tuberculosis and morphine addiction.<o:p></o:p></span><br />

<span style="font-family: 'Times New Roman', serif; font-size: 12pt; line-height: 18.399999618530273px;">Heroin is a highly addictive drug derived from morphine, an opiate extracted from poppy. It is a downer/depressant which affects the brain’s pleasure system, interfering with its ability to perceive pain. It belongs to the narcotics – a group of pain-relieving drugs. Certain narcotics are legal if prescribed by doctors. Heroin, however, is illegal because of its adverse effects on the user and it is very addictive.</span></div>

<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">Usually, heroin looks
like a white to dark brown powder or a black sticky substance (black tar
heroin) but in its purest form, it appears to be a fine, white powder. The
color comes from the additives such as sugar and caffeine that are used to
dilute it. These additives do not fully dissolve which causes the clogging of
blood vessels when injected.<o:p></o:p></span><br />
<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;"><br /></span>
<br />
<div class="MsoNormal">
<b><span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">STREET HEROIN<o:p></o:p></span></b></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<b><span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;"><br /></span></b></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">Street heroin varies in
color due to the substances mixed with it. Usually, a bag contains 100 mg of
powder which ranges from about 1-98% heroin. Additives such as sugar, starch
and powdered milk are mixed with heroin to cut/dilute it so that the dealer
will earn more money selling it.<o:p></o:p></span></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;"><br /></span></div>
<div class="MsoNormal">
<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">Another form is the
black tar heroin which is either sticky or formed in large clumps like coal and
contains about 20-80% heroin. It also contains impurities and additives.<o:p></o:p></span></div>

<span style="font-family: "Times New Roman","serif"; font-size: 12.0pt; line-height: 115%;">The most effective form
of consumption is injection. Heroin is dissolved by mixing it with water (or
any additive) and heated. When it boils, it is drawn into a hypodermic needle.
“Skin popping” is the process wherein the solution is injected just below the
skin and “Mainlining” is the process of injection into the vein.<o:p></o:p></span></div>
